Estimate the Machining Time
A hollow workpiece of 60 mm outside diameter and 150 mm length is held on a mandrel among centers and turned all over in 4 passes. If the approach length = 20 mm, over travel = 12 mm, average feed = 0.8 mm/rev., cutting speed = 30 m/min, estimate the machining time.
Solution
We know that,
Cutting speed = π DN /1000
or, 30 = ( 60 × π N )/1000
N = 159 rpm
Now, the total (length) traveled by the tool in a single pass in given by :
L = 150 + 20 + 12
= 182 mm
Therefore, the total length traveled by the tool in its 4 passes is given by :
L1 = 182 × 4 = 728 mm
Now, the machining time (T) is given by following:
T = L1/ feed × N
= 728 / (0.8 × 1.59)
= 5.72 minutes
